Inhaltsverzeichnis
Wie können Sie eine reaktionsschnelle Form erstellen, die sich an verschiedene Bildschirmgrößen anpasst?
Was sind die besten Praktiken für die Gestaltung mobilfreundlicher Formularlayouts?
Welche CSS -Frameworks können dazu beitragen, reaktionsschnelle Formen für verschiedene Geräte aufzubauen?
Wie testen Sie die Reaktionsfähigkeit eines Formulars über verschiedene Bildschirmgrößen hinweg?
Heim Web-Frontend HTML-Tutorial Wie können Sie eine reaktionsschnelle Form erstellen, die sich an verschiedene Bildschirmgrößen anpasst?

Wie können Sie eine reaktionsschnelle Form erstellen, die sich an verschiedene Bildschirmgrößen anpasst?

Mar 26, 2025 pm 01:56 PM

Wie können Sie eine reaktionsschnelle Form erstellen, die sich an verschiedene Bildschirmgrößen anpasst?

Das Erstellen einer reaktionsschnellen Form, die sich nahtlos an verschiedene Bildschirmgrößen anpasst, beinhaltet eine Kombination aus nachdenklichem Design und technischer Implementierung. Hier sind die Schritte, die Sie unternehmen können:

  1. Verwenden Sie relative Einheiten : Verwenden Sie anstelle von festen Pixelgrößen relative Einheiten wie Prozentsätze, EMS oder REMs für Breiten, Ränder und Paddings. Dies stellt sicher, dass die Formelemente mit dem Ansichtsfenster skalieren.
  2. Flexible Gitterlayouts : Verwenden Sie CSS -Gitter oder Flexbox, um ein Flüssigkeitslayout zu erstellen. Diese Layoutsysteme ermöglichen es Formularelementen, sich auf der Grundlage des verfügbaren Raums neu zu ordnen. Zum Beispiel können Sie display: flex in einem Container festlegen und verwenden Sie flex-wrap: wrap , damit Elemente auf kleinere Bildschirme in die nächste Zeile einwickeln können.
  3. Medienabfragen : Implementieren Sie Medienabfragen, um bestimmte Stilanpassungen an verschiedenen Haltepunkten vorzunehmen. Sie können beispielsweise das Layout des Formulars anpassen oder nicht wesentliche Elemente auf kleineren Bildschirmen mit @media -Regeln ausblenden.

     <code class="css">@media (max-width: 768px) { form { width: 100%; } }</code>
    Nach dem Login kopieren
  4. Responsive Eingabefelder : Stellen Sie sicher, dass die Eingabefelder gut skalieren. Verwenden Sie beispielsweise width: 100% für Texteingaben, um sie auf kleineren Bildschirmen vollständig zu entwickeln.
  5. Mobile-First-Ansatz : Entwerfen Sie Ihr Formular mit einer mobilen Einstellung. Stylen Sie zunächst das Formular für kleinere Bildschirme und verwenden Sie dann Medienabfragen, um das Layout für größere Bildschirme zu verbessern.
  6. Berührungsfreundliche Elemente : Machen Sie Tasten und Verbindungen, die groß genug für Berührungswechselwirkungen sind, und gewährleisten Sie einen ausreichenden Abstand, um versehentliche Wasserhähne zu verhindern.

Wenn Sie diese Schritte ausführen, können Sie ein Formular erstellen, das sowohl funktional als auch ästhetisch ansprechend in verschiedenen Gerätegrößen ist.

Was sind die besten Praktiken für die Gestaltung mobilfreundlicher Formularlayouts?

Das Entwerfen von mobilfreundlichen Formularlayouts beinhaltet die Berücksichtigung der einzigartigen Einschränkungen von mobilen Geräten wie kleineren Bildschirmgrößen und berührungsbasierten Interaktionen. Hier sind einige Best Practices:

  1. Vereinfachen Sie das Formular : Reduzieren Sie die Anzahl der Felder auf die wesentlichen. Lange Formen sind auf mobilen Geräten umständlich und können zu Frustration der Benutzer führen.
  2. Etikettenplatzierung : Verwenden Sie Inline -Etiketten oder Platzhaltertext, um Platz zu sparen. Schwimmende Beschriftungen, die sich beim Eintippen nach oben bewegen, können effektiv sein und mehr Platz für Eingabefelder bieten.
  3. Große Berührungsziele : Stellen Sie sicher, dass Tasten und Eingangsfelder groß genug sind, um ein einfaches Tippen zu erhalten. Die empfohlene Mindestgröße für Berührungsziele beträgt 44 x 44 Pixel.
  4. Einspaltlayout : Entscheiden Sie sich für ein einspaltiges Layout, um sicherzustellen, dass Benutzer nicht horizontal scrollen müssen. Dies ist besonders wichtig für mobile Geräte, auf denen vertikaler Scrollen natürlicher ist.
  5. Progressive Offenlegung : Verwenden Sie Techniken wie Akkordeons oder mehrstufige Formulare, um Informationen in überschaubaren Brocken darzustellen. Dies verhindert, dass der Benutzer überwältigt wird und das Formular auf kleineren Bildschirmen mehr verdaulich macht.
  6. Fehlerbehandlung und -validierung : Zeigen Sie Fehlermeldungen klar und in der Nähe der entsprechenden Felder an. Verwenden Sie die Inline -Validierung, um den Benutzern sofortiges Feedback bereitzustellen, wenn sie das Formular ausfüllen.
  7. Überlegungen zum Tastatur : Entwurfsformulare mit unterschiedlichen Tastaturtypen. Verwenden Sie input[type="email"] , input[type="tel"] und andere spezifische Eingangstypen, um die entsprechende Tastatur auf mobilen Geräten auszulösen, wodurch die Dateneingabe einfacher wird.

Durch die Einhaltung dieser Best Practices können Sie die Benutzererfahrung auf mobilen Geräten erheblich verbessern.

Welche CSS -Frameworks können dazu beitragen, reaktionsschnelle Formen für verschiedene Geräte aufzubauen?

Mehrere CSS -Frameworks können die Erstellung reaktionsschneller Formen für verschiedene Geräte erleichtern. Hier sind einige der beliebtesten:

  1. Bootstrap : Bootstrap wird weit verbreitet und verfügt über ein robustes Gittersystem, mit dem reaktionsschnelle Layouts einfach erstellt werden können. Es bietet vorgefertigte Formularkomponenten, die mobilfreundlich sind.

     <code class="html"><form class="row g-3"> <div class="col-md-6"> <label for="inputEmail4" class="form-label">Email</label> <input type="email" class="form-control" id="inputEmail4"> </div> <!-- More form fields --> </form></code>
    Nach dem Login kopieren
  2. Foundation : Foundation ist ein weiteres beliebtes Framework, das das mobile Design hervorhebt. Es bietet ein flexibles Netzsystem und eine reaktionsschnelle Formkomponenten.
  3. Tailwind CSS : Tailwind ist ein Utility-First CSS-Framework, das hochpassbare reaktionsschnelle Designs ermöglicht. Es ist besonders nützlich, um einzigartige Formlayouts zu erstellen, die sich gut an verschiedene Bildschirmgrößen anpassen.

     <code class="html"><form class="space-y-4"> <div> <label for="email" class="block mb-2 text-sm font-medium text-gray-900">Your email</label> <input type="email" id="email" class="bg-gray-50 border border-gray-300 text-gray-900 text-sm rounded-lg focus:ring-blue-500 focus:border-blue-500 block w-full p-2.5" placeholder="name@flowbite.com" required> </div> <!-- More form fields --> </form></code>
    Nach dem Login kopieren
  4. Bulma : Bulma ist ein modernes CSS -Framework, das einfach zu bedienen ist und reaktionsschnelle Formelemente bietet. Das Netzsystem ist intuitiv und hilft bei der Erstellung von mobilfreundlichen Layouts.

Jedes dieser Frameworks hat seine Stärken und kann basierend auf Projektbedürfnissen und persönlichen Vorlieben ausgewählt werden. Sie alle vereinfachen den Prozess des Erstellens reaktionsschneller Formen, die über verschiedene Geräte hinweg gut funktionieren.

Wie testen Sie die Reaktionsfähigkeit eines Formulars über verschiedene Bildschirmgrößen hinweg?

Das Testen der Reaktionsfähigkeit eines Formulars über verschiedene Bildschirmgrößen hinweg ist entscheidend, um eine konsistente Benutzererfahrung zu gewährleisten. Hier sind einige Methoden, um Ihre reaktionsschnellen Formulare effektiv zu testen:

  1. Browser -Entwickler -Tools : Die meisten modernen Browser sind mit Entwickler -Tools ausgestattet, mit denen Sie verschiedene Bildschirmgrößen simulieren können. In Chrome können Sie beispielsweise die Entwickler -Tools öffnen, in die "Geräte -Symbolleiste" wechseln und Ihr Formular auf verschiedenen vordefinierten Gerätegrößen oder benutzerdefinierten Abmessungen testen.
  2. Tools für Responsive Design -Tests : Verwenden Sie Tools wie Respectinator, BrowsStack oder Cross -BrowStesting, um Ihr Formular auf mehreren Geräten und Browsern gleichzeitig anzuzeigen. Diese Tools bieten eine effiziente Möglichkeit, um festzustellen, wie sich Ihr Formular auf verschiedenen Bildschirmgrößen verhält, ohne alle Geräte zu besitzen.
  3. Echte Geräte : Das Testen auf tatsächlichen mobilen Geräten, Tablets und Desktops ist die genaueste Methode. Testen Sie nach Möglichkeit auf einer Reihe von Geräten, um sicherzustellen, dass Ihre Formular unter realen Bedingungen gut funktioniert.
  4. Ansichtsfenster -Meta -Tag : Stellen Sie sicher, dass Ihr HTML das Ansichtsfenster -Meta -Tag enthält, um die Größe und Skalierung des Ansichtsfensatzes auf mobilen Geräten zu steuern.

     <code class="html"><meta name="viewport" content="width=device-width, initial-scale=1"></code>
    Nach dem Login kopieren
  5. Automatisierte Tests : Verwenden Sie automatisierte Test -Frameworks wie Selen oder Cypress, um Tests zu schreiben, die die Reaktionsfähigkeit Ihres Formulars über verschiedene Bildschirmgrößen überprüft werden. Diese Tests können wiederholt durchgeführt werden, um alle während der Entwicklung eingeführten Probleme zu erfassen.
  6. Benutzertests : Führen Sie Usability -Tests mit echten Benutzern auf verschiedenen Geräten durch, um Feedback zur Reaktionsfähigkeit und Benutzererfahrung des Formulars zu sammeln. Dies kann Probleme aufdecken, die automatisierte Tools möglicherweise vermissen.

Durch die Verwendung dieser Testmethoden können Sie sicher sicherstellen, dass Ihr reaktionsschnelles Formular für alle Zielgeräte und Bildschirmgrößen gut funktioniert.

Das obige ist der detaillierte Inhalt vonWie können Sie eine reaktionsschnelle Form erstellen, die sich an verschiedene Bildschirmgrößen anpasst?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

Video Face Swap

Video Face Swap

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Ist HTML für Anfänger leicht zu lernen? Ist HTML für Anfänger leicht zu lernen? Apr 07, 2025 am 12:11 AM

HTML ist für Anfänger geeignet, da es einfach und leicht zu lernen ist und schnell Ergebnisse sehen kann. 1) Die Lernkurve von HTML ist glatt und leicht zu beginnen. 2) Beherrschen Sie einfach die grundlegenden Tags, um Webseiten zu erstellen. 3) hohe Flexibilität und kann in Kombination mit CSS und JavaScript verwendet werden. 4) Reiche Lernressourcen und moderne Tools unterstützen den Lernprozess.

Die Rollen von HTML, CSS und JavaScript: Kernverantwortung Die Rollen von HTML, CSS und JavaScript: Kernverantwortung Apr 08, 2025 pm 07:05 PM

HTML definiert die Webstruktur, CSS ist für Stil und Layout verantwortlich, und JavaScript ergibt eine dynamische Interaktion. Die drei erfüllen ihre Aufgaben in der Webentwicklung und erstellen gemeinsam eine farbenfrohe Website.

HTML, CSS und JavaScript verstehen: Ein Anfängerhandbuch HTML, CSS und JavaScript verstehen: Ein Anfängerhandbuch Apr 12, 2025 am 12:02 AM

WebdevelopmentRelieSonHtml, CSS und JavaScript: 1) HtmlStructuresContent, 2) CSSstylesit und 3) JavaScriptaddssinteraktivität, Bildung von TheBasisofModerernwebexperiences.

Gitee Pages statische Website -Bereitstellung fehlgeschlagen: Wie können Sie einzelne Dateien 404 Fehler beheben und beheben? Gitee Pages statische Website -Bereitstellung fehlgeschlagen: Wie können Sie einzelne Dateien 404 Fehler beheben und beheben? Apr 04, 2025 pm 11:54 PM

GitePages statische Website -Bereitstellung fehlgeschlagen: 404 Fehlerbehebung und Auflösung bei der Verwendung von Gitee ...

Was ist ein Beispiel für ein Start -Tag in HTML? Was ist ein Beispiel für ein Start -Tag in HTML? Apr 06, 2025 am 12:04 AM

AnexampleofaTartingTaginHtmlis, die, die starttagsaresesinginhtmlastheyinitiateElements, definetheirtypes, andarecrucialForstructuringwebpages und -konstruktionsthedoms.

Wie verwendet ich CSS3 und JavaScript, um den Effekt der Streuung und Vergrößerung der umgebenden Bilder nach dem Klicken zu erreichen? Wie verwendet ich CSS3 und JavaScript, um den Effekt der Streuung und Vergrößerung der umgebenden Bilder nach dem Klicken zu erreichen? Apr 05, 2025 am 06:15 AM

Um den Effekt der Streuung und Vergrößerung der umgebenden Bilder nach dem Klicken auf das Bild zu erreichen, müssen viele Webdesigns einen interaktiven Effekt erzielen: Klicken Sie auf ein bestimmtes Bild, um die Umgebung zu machen ...

HTML, CSS und JavaScript: Wesentliche Tools für Webentwickler HTML, CSS und JavaScript: Wesentliche Tools für Webentwickler Apr 09, 2025 am 12:12 AM

HTML, CSS und JavaScript sind die drei Säulen der Webentwicklung. 1. HTML definiert die Webseitenstruktur und verwendet Tags wie z.

Wie unterscheidet ich zwischen dem Schließen eines Browser -Registerkartens und dem Schließen des gesamten Browsers mit JavaScript? Wie unterscheidet ich zwischen dem Schließen eines Browser -Registerkartens und dem Schließen des gesamten Browsers mit JavaScript? Apr 04, 2025 pm 10:21 PM

Wie unterscheidet ich zwischen den Registerkarten und dem Schließen des gesamten Browsers mit JavaScript in Ihrem Browser? Während der täglichen Verwendung des Browsers können Benutzer ...

See all articles